创建一个元素并在其上设置属性。
noder.createElement(tag,props)
Example: 点击按钮添加文本为 world 的 p 元素在 div 元素中。
<!DOCTYPE html>
<html>
<head>
<style>
div {border: 2px solid blue;}
p { background: yellow; margin: 4px;}
</style>
<script type="text/javascript" src="https://cdnjs.cloudflare.com/ajax/libs/require.js/2.3.3/require.min.js"></script>
<script>
require.config({
baseUrl: "./",
packages: [{
name: "skylark",
location: "../../../src/skylark"
}, ]
});
</script>
</head>
<body>
<button>Click</button>
<div>Hello</div>
<script>
require(["skylark/query", "skylark/noder"], function($, noder) {
$("button").on("click", function() {
$("div").addContent(noder.createElement("p", {
innerHTML: "world!"
}));
});
});
</script>
</body>
</html>